Why We Loved Being Gods (and Monsters)
Black and White tapped into something primal: the desire to nurture and the temptation to dominate. It was a moral playground where the only limit was your imagination (and maybe the villagers' sanity).
The Creature AI was surprisingly advanced. It learned from your actions, both good and bad. Slap it enough, and you'd end up with a grumpy, destructive behemoth.

Praise it, teach it cool tricks, and you had a loyal, fluffy powerhouse that would defend your worshippers with its very… well, everything.

A Blast from the Past (With Caveats)
Trying to run Black and White on modern systems can be a bit of a headache. Compatibility issues are practically guaranteed.
Expect to spend some time tweaking settings, hunting down patches, and maybe even sacrificing a small digital goat to the PC gods.

But if you can get it running, it's worth it. The quirky gameplay, the morally ambiguous choices, and the sheer scale of the world still hold up today.
